Lady Ceraratha, or Cera as she prefers, is the daughter of a Rethwellan wool merchant. She was married to the abusive Lord Sinmonkelrath, who was killed in the assassination attempt[1] on Queen Selenay. In the wake of the attempt, Selenay took Cera's fealty oath and granted her Sandbriar, a war-weary holding in southern Valdemar which had originally been allotted to her late, unlamented husband.
When Cera arrived in Sandbriar, she found a land and people in trouble, drained by the Tedrel Wars. She used her connections as the daughter of a prominent merchant, as well as her wide range of knowledge and experience, especially where sheep and fibers are concerned, to set Sandbriar back on its feet.

Lady Cera is the main character in the Lady Cera Miniseries by Elizabeth A. Vaughan, appearing in the following works:
- "Unintended Consequences," Finding the Way and Other Tales of Valdemar, Valdemar Anthology, volume 6
- "Consequences Unforeseen," No True Way, Valdemar Anthology, volume 8
- "Unresolved Consequences," Crucible, Valdemar Anthology, volume 9
- "Unimagined Consequences," Tempest, Valdemar Anthology, volume 10
- "Unexpected Consequences," Pathways, Valdemar Anthology, volume 11
- "Unceasing Consequences," Choices, Valdemar Anthology, volume 12,
- "Unknowable Consequences," Seasons, Valdemar Anthology, volume 13
- "Expected Consequences," Passages, Valdemar Anthology, volume 14
- "Final Consequences," Boundaries, Valdemar Anthology, volume 15
